Restaurants offering 1. Labatt Blue
Search city
4.1
Menu
Table booking
4.1
Menu
Table booking
City: Mackinac County, 1485 Astor Street, Mackinac Island, 49757, United States Of America, Mackinac County
"Great staff, awesome food. Those duck wontons are a must-have."
Feedback
These reviews refer only to the mentioned ingredients.